Spoiler Alert: If you haven’t watched the latest episode of ‘Game of Thrones’ please do so before coming back to this article. Kit Harington recently revealed that he was just as shocked as viewers when it was revealed that Arya Stark killed the Night King and not his character.
Avid ‘GOT’ fans have been bracing themselves for the biggest action episode since ‘Battle of the Bastards’ and were completely shocked when the youngest Stark took a legendary jab at the Night King and killed him in mid-air. Readers of the books and viewerss of the show know that it is heavily implied that Jon Snow or Daenerys Targaryen were the only two who could’ve put an end to the endless night bringer and his army of White Walkers.
Kit Harington told Entertainment Weekly: “I was slightly pissed off I was on a dragon, it stops me from fighting in a crowd. It’s going to look cool but I wanted, in some ways — just as Jon does — to get back down on the ground. The fact he can fly a dragon means he has to but his place is down there amongst the sword swingers.”
Kit wasn’t the only one who questioned the decision, Maisie Williams was also surprised that her character was chosen to save the day.
“I immediately thought that everybody would hate it; that Arya doesn’t deserve it”
She then realized that Arya was the only one who had the training to outsmart the enemy.
“When we did the whole bit with Melisandre, I realized the whole scene with [the Red Woman] brings it back to everything I’ve been working for over these past 6 seasons—4 if you think about it since [Arya] got to the House of Black and White. It all comes down to this one very moment. It’s also unexpected and that’s what this show does. So then I was like, ‘F*** you Jon, I get it.'”
